Patna, 18th Sept: Bharatiya Janata Party’s (BJP) Bihar president Dilip Jaiswal on Thursday hit out at the Congress party over an AI-generated video of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s late mother, Heeraben Modi, calling it a “shameful act” that reflects the “declining political integrity” of the INDIA alliance.
Jaiswal’s remarks came after the Patna High Court directed the Congress to take down the controversial video from all social media platforms. The video, circulated by Bihar Congress, showed an artificial intelligence depiction of the Prime Minister’s late mother scolding him over his politics — sparking outrage within the BJP and its allies.
“I welcome the Patna High Court order. The way they posted an AI video on the Prime Minister and his mother, the Congress Party has committed a shameful act. The INDI alliance is losing its political integrity. After this Patna High Court order, it is expected they will learn a lesson,” Jaiswal told reporters.
He further said that the court’s intervention sets an important precedent.
“This order, I think, is a good message for the future. It will also curb the misuse of social media,” he added.
A Growing Political Flashpoint
The AI video controversy has emerged at a politically sensitive time, with Bihar heading for assembly elections later this year. The ruling National Democratic Alliance (NDA), led by Chief Minister Nitish Kumar, is preparing to retain power, while the opposition INDIA bloc, comprising Congress and Rashtriya Janata Dal (RJD), is positioning itself as a challenger.
In neighbouring Uttar Pradesh, state minister and NDA ally OP Rajbhar voiced confidence in the alliance’s prospects, asserting that the NDA would comfortably form the next government in Bihar.
“An NDA coalition government will be formed in Bihar and we will fight together,” Rajbhar said.
The Debate on AI and Ethics in Politics
The Patna High Court’s decision also reignites the debate around the ethical use of artificial intelligence in political campaigns. Experts warn that AI-generated deepfakes have the potential to distort political discourse, mislead voters, and cross ethical boundaries when personal lives of leaders are dragged into public campaigns.
For the BJP, the incident has become a rallying point to question Congress’s strategy and the credibility of the INDIA alliance. For the Congress, the High Court’s intervention is a setback at a time when it is striving to consolidate opposition unity in Bihar.
